Biology (Communicable Disease) Flashcards
4 types of pathogens?
Viruses, Bacteria, Fungi and Protists
What is a communicable disease?
Diseases that can be spread by person to person or animal to animal.
Are all microorganisms pathogens?
No
How can communicable diseases be spread?
Air, Contact and Water
What is the majority of communicable disease in people?
Bacteria and Viruses
Are bacteria unicellular?
Yes
What’s the name of the process when bacteria divides in two?
Binary Fission
Are viruses true organisms?
No, they don’t have cellular structures, they are made from RNA/DNA strand enclosed in a protein coat.
